Penzance station was opened in 1852, but had major redevelopment in 1876. The new rock-faced granite building was designed by William Lancaster Owen.

A photograph of Sennen harbour, taken in September 1896, showing a number of fishermen and their boats. The round building was originally built in 1876 to house the capstan wheel that was used to winch boats up the harbour slipway.
